Largest Fraternity (Excluding Cultural & Honors) - Tau Kappa Epsilon
TKE

Via

TKE is one of the largest fraternities not only by GreekRank records, but in North America, with over 272,000 initiated members and 235 active chapters and colonies. We’re happy to see those impressive numbers tied to an organization with the mission, “TKE Builds Better Men for a Better World.” Their most popular chapter? Keene State College in New Hampshire, with 29 ratings on GreekRank.com.

Largest Fraternity (Including Cultural & Honors) - Alpha Phi Alpha
Alpha Phi Alpha

Via

There’s no question Alpha Phi Alpha is one of the largest fraternities (including cultural and honors) -- they have 706 chapters and 200,000+ living members (and over 850,000 community service hours worked, a key part of the organization’s philosphy) -- with history to boot. The organization describes itself as one whose members led the Civil Rights Act, led the charge in the historic court case Brown v. Board, and founded and supported institutions such as the National Association for the Advancement of Colored People, The Crisis magazine, National Urban League and the National Association of Black Journalists. Largest Sorority (Including Cultural & Honors) - Alpha Kappa Alpha
AKA

Via

The salmon pink and apple green colors that define AKA make the sisters stand out, if its 958 chapters nationwide don’t already. With historic beginnings -- its founders were among the fewer than 1,000 African-Americans enrolled in higher education institutions in 1908 -- AKA lives by the credo, “To be supreme in service to all mankind.”
